Kalpataru Limited Reports Q1 FY27 Consolidated Net Loss Narrows to ₹26.52 Crore; Revenue Rises 6.5% to ₹472 Crore, Net Debt at ₹8,229 Crore
Narrowed Quarterly Loss on Higher Collections
Kalpataru's consolidated net loss (attributable to owners of the parent) narrowed to ₹26.52 crore in the quarter ended June 30, 2026 (Q1 FY27), from ₹49.42 crore in Q1 FY26, aided by strong operational momentum despite a challenging real estate cycle driven by the project completion method (PCM) of revenue recognition.
Kalpataru's revenue for Q1 FY27 grew 6.54 per cent year-on-year to ₹472.20 crore. Total expenses during the same period rose 7.14 per cent YoY to ₹548.81 crore, reflecting the timing mismatch inherent in PCM accounting, where project costs are fully expensed regardless of revenue recognition timing.
Strong Collections Outpace Sales Bookings
The quarter showcased stronger cash generation than new project demand. Kalpataru reported a 6 per cent YoY increase in pre-sales to ₹1,329 crore for Q1 FY27. Its collections during the quarter rose 17 per cent YoY to ₹1,365 crore, indicating robust realization from completed and nearing-completion projects.
The developer sold 0.82 million square feet (msf) in Q1 FY27, up 48 per cent YoY. However, its average sales realisation stood at ₹16,177 per square foot in Q1 FY27, down 28 per cent YoY, reflecting a strategic pivot toward higher-volume, mid-premium segment sales in a period where luxury ultra-high-net-worth units had constrained movement.
EBITDA and Operating Profitability
The company's adjusted ear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ortisation (Ebitda) for Q1 FY27 declined 8.65 per cent YoY to ₹95 crore. The EBITDA contraction reflects the fixed cost burden of marketing, corporate overhead, and personnel expenses booked upfront under PCM, before corresponding revenue recognition from project occupancy certificates.
Balance Sheet and Debt
As of 30 June 2026, Kalpataru's net debt stood at Rs 8,229 crore, with a net debt-to-equity ratio of 2.0x. The company remains focused on debt reduction using IPO proceeds and improved operating collections.
Project Launches and Portfolio Expansion
During the quarter, the developer expanded its footprint with new launches, including luxury residential projects like Kalpataru Vian and Hrushikesh in Lokhandwala, and Tower C of Estella at Kalpataru Parkcity in Thane. Furthermore, the company added a redevelopment project in Kandivali, Mumbai, with an estimated gross development value of ₹1,250 crore.

About Kalpataru Limited
Founded in 1988, Kalpataru Limited is a real estate development company based in Mumbai, Maharashtra. Kalpataru Limited is an integrated real estate development company with over 130+ completed projects across Mumbai, Thane, Panvel, Pune, Hyderabad, Indore, Bengaluru, and Jodhpur. Specializing in luxury, premium, and mid-income residential, commercial, and retail developments, the company manages all aspects of real estate development, from land acquisition to design, construction, and sales.
